u/neelakukkad Feb 02 '26
It's called Non Fare box revenue. Revenue generated from sources other than passengers. Like Real Estate or in this case - Branding

u/NefariousnessNo6005 Feb 02 '26
Just to explain to someone who doesn’t know
These stations issue contracts to various companies for Branding, under these contract you get naming rights, announcements and recognition at every stage possible (Name in maps, tickets, and anywhere possible)
These contracts run for a year, hence the names keep changing
The amount at which they issue these contacts is a bomb hence most brands can’t continue more than a year
